Haiti opens door for return of ex-president Aristide

PORT-AU-PRINCE | Mon Jan 31, 2011 4:12pm EST

PORT-AU-PRINCE Jan 31 (Reuters) - Haiti's government is ready to issue a diplomatic passport to ousted former President Jean-Bertrand Aristide, opening the way for his possible return home from exile in South Africa, a senior official said on Monday.

"The Council of Ministers, under the leadership of President Rene Preval, decided that a diplomatic passport be issued to President Aristide, if he asks for it," Fritz Longchamp, general secretary for the presidency, told Reuters.
